Output 850d1267806ccfafb5c5bae1afe7f9c52407b7adbeb7d7074ab5a4b5b3d4fa29:2

value
3928972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acd9893f0e0a8d5784abbdb14d4e2a555362975f OP_EQUAL
address
3HSxkDK28m2z4KQYQ9exXLPkWrLmWQcdu8
transaction
850d1267806ccfafb5c5bae1afe7f9c52407b7adbeb7d7074ab5a4b5b3d4fa29
confirmations
232250
spent
true